Rogue Descent is a challenging roguelite that strongly promotes cognitive skills. Players must engage in strategic planning, critical thinking, and adaptive problem-solving to navigate ever-changing dungeons and make wise choices regarding loot and events. The permanent death mechanic, combined with unlockable classes and boons, fosters learning transfer and resilience as players learn from failures to improve subsequent runs.

While Rogue Descent avoids significant monetization and social risks, its roguelite design incorporates variable rewards and escalating commitment through unlocks and increasing difficulty levels, which can encourage prolonged engagement. The game features combat violence and some atmospheric fear elements, which parents should consider.
